The torpedo hit on ARK ROYAL was serious; but put the ship in no immediate danger of sinking The prompt application of counterflooding and standard damage control procedures would have saved the ship.

The Official Investigation also concluded that there were a variety of design factors contributing to the loss:

1The uninterrupted boiler room flat was a significant error that was immediately rectified in the Illustrious and Indefatigable class.
2The adoption of a double hangar had forced the use of cross-deck uptakes low in the ship adding to vulnerability.
3The reliance on steam generators was also an error and diesel generators were back-fitted to the subsequent armoured carriers.
4 The power train design itself was strongly criticized.

Prince of Wales'gun turret problems in the Battle of Denmark Strait

After the sinking of HMS Hood- serious gunnery malfunctions had caused intermittent problems with the POW;s main armament, leading to a 26% reduction in output. Captain Leach realised that continuing the action would risk losing Prince of Wales without inflicting further damage on the enemy. He therefore ordered the ship to make smoke and withdraw, 'pending a more favourable opportunity'.

Prince of Wales turned away just after 06:04, firing from her rear turret under local control until the turret suffered a jammed shell ring, cutting off the ammunition supply and making the guns inoperable. Despite efforts by crew members and civilian technicians to repair the shell ring, all four guns were not back in service until 08:25, although two of the four guns were serviceable by 07:20. This temporarily left only five 14 in (360 mm) guns operational, but nine of the ten were operational in five hours.The final salvos fired were ragged and are believed to have fallen short.

This ship had been pressed into serious action before she was really fit for such a purpose

As for Allied ships taking severe damage - one could easily show USS South Dakota (suffering heavy topside damage from 26-27 shells at Guadalcanal, and over 100 casualties), USS Colorado, heavily damaged by 3x150mm shore guns during the Pacific campaign, North Carolina suffering 1xlong lance torpedo hit, and several battleships suffering heavy hits from kamikazes.
Problem here for the South Dakota - I'll reference War report #57 from the US Navy:
In spite of numerous hits, SOUTH DAKOTA received only superficial damage. Neither the strength, buoyancy nor stability were measurably impaired.
Also,
It is estimated that one hit was 5-inch, six were 6-inch, eighteen were 8-inch and one was 14-inch.


There was only 1 shell that hit that should have a reasonable chance of causing any type of significant damage to a battleship of the South Dakota Class. Most of the hits should not have penetrated the armor, therefore the minor damage as listed above was sustained. Hit's to the superstructure are generally not going to be serious.

A Truer test for the South Dakota would be to see how it performed when hit by 16" Shells. Same thing for many pf the other vessels - North Carolina is hit by 1 torpedo. What would 4 or so torpedoes do in rapid succession, or 12 or more torpedoes in volleys of 3-4 every hour?

That's my point about damage, we have one torpedo here, a couple bombs on a different vessel.

And really, small naval cannon and most bombs pose little threat for a true battleship.

As a side note, it's interesting that some think the naval battles around Guadacanal show that US Battleships were superior to Japanese ones. In actuality, what it shows is that in World War 2, a Battleship (actually even with armor upgrades the Kongo class were really more in the battlecruiser class) comissioned prior to WW1 was not a good match for a recently comissioned battleship, and it also proves that 14" Guns are not a match for 16" guns.

This is an interesting topic and I agree that the failures of ship designers are only revealed when things go wrong or at least when someone with no commitment to the design process examines the design. For example, the RN criticized USN turrets as not being flash tight by their standards after examining USS Washington but we had to wait for the accident on USS Iowa for a test. The accident revealed that the barriers separating individual guns failed but at least the explosion did not pass towards the magazines.

Sometimes “weak points” depend on how the ship is going to be used. For example, the forward bulkhead of South Dakota or Iowa was 10 inches thick whilst King George had 12 “inch” armour (480 lb.) forward and 10 inch aft. If South Dakota had steered towards Bismarck as King George V did during Bismarck's final battle, a lucky hit could have penetrated the magazine. However, the USN intended to fight at long range rather than rushing to close the range.

Aircraft carriers seem to offer a variety of lessons. Ark Royal sank after one torpedo hit because all electrical power was lost (less than a month later, shock from a single torpedo disabled much of Prince of Wales electrical generation) and poor damage control failed to restore power. However, note that Ark Royal did not sink in flames. Lexington, Wasp and later Shokaku, Taiho and Hiyo would suffer ruptured aviation fuel tanks after torpedo hits. Hiryu was lost because the heat of the fires in her hangars forced the evacuation of her engine rooms and one might imagine that Shokaku or an Essex would have survived with an extra deck in between. However, in 1945 Franklin suffered the same loss of power because the air intakes to the machinery spaces took in smoke from her burning hangar and again forced the crew out.

There is a natural bias that the “weak points” are better remembered than the strong points. For example, the Littorio Class had very strong armour over the armament and magazines and much weaker elsewhere. The 200 mm thick turret roof was hit by bombs dropped by a B-24 on Littorio and by a Lancaster on Roma and nothing much happened, so that strength is forgotten although only the Yamato Class had thicker armour at that point (230 mm). I am guessing but I suspect that Littorio would have survived the hit that wrecked Gneisenau with minor damage.

Everyone remembers that Littorio just about sank after being hit by three torpedoes at Taranto. However, one cannot conclude that the Pugliese side protection system failed because the torpedoes were magnetically fused and set to run beneath the anti-torpedo netting. The hit in the citadel flooded most of the double bottom and the forward magazines from below.

So given that explosions below the keel have a terrible reputation, would any other ship have performed better? Well at least one of the two ton charges of amatol used in Operation Source exploded close to Tirpitz (probably not exactly beneath the ship), so it looks as if the often criticised designers of the Bismarck class deserve a little praise.

Battleship rudders are a fascinating topic. We know that Bismarck, Prince of Wales, Richelieu and Yamato were vulnerable to single torpedo hits as were the aircraft carriers Akagi and Intrepid. We also know that the Littorio Class could retain the ability to steer after any single hit as they had three rudders with 25 metres between the main and auxiliary rudders and the two auxiliary rudders were designed to be capable of steering the ship even if the main rudder was jammed. The issue to debate is whether the American battleships with 24 ft between their two rudders could have been disabled by a single torpedo.

Was HIEI mortally wounded after BOTH gunfire and air attacks were completed, and was the Japanese scuttling action redundant? This has the potential to cause debate similar to that engendered about the BISMARCK's scuttling.Nonetheless, given the subsequent behaviour following underwater damage of sister battleship KIRISHIMA it appears quite likely that the scuttling WAS redundant.

Indeed, there is some question of whether it took place before Yamamoto's countermand. In any case with as many as three or more torpedo hits HIEI was already listing increasingly and progressive flooding spreading. KIRISHIMA ultimately would founder without scuttling.

One final mystery defies solution. Where did HIEI sink? The Ballard underwater search failed to locate the battleship's wreck. The capsized hull of the Kongo-class battleship found was in truth but never definitively identified. A magazine explosion had demolished the forepart, but no marked other damage was discerned. Except one. The extreme fantail of the wreck was severed and broken. Could this be a result of HIEI's stern torpedo damage? Is this, the HIEI, and not the KIRISHIMA as usually assumed?

KIRISHIMA's Action Report states that she capsized and sank in a position bearing 265 degrees, 11 miles from Savo Island's summit. Ugaki's diary entry the day prior gives the same reference point, but states the bearing as 285 degrees, 8 miles.(09-05'S, 159-42'E). Thus, the only clear indication is that the KIRISHIMA sank at a point something like due west 8-11 miles from the summit of Savo Island. For HIEI, S.E. Morison gives a position 5 miles NNW of Savo Island.

The last precisely reported position of the HIEI was "drifting in an area bearing 347 degrees, distance 4.6 miles from Savo Island". Since this was at 1305 hours, is it possible that drift might have brought her close to the 1992 wreck site? Perhaps, perhaps not. Unfortunately, this is a question only further search can answer.

However, given that the August 1992 battleship wreck was reportedly only a mile from the supposed sinking site, and some reports mention an undersea detonation after she sank, odds are that it is indeed the KIRISHIMA.

I think that much of the real issue I'm speaking about here may be sample base.

For instance, the North Carolina and Yamato each get struck by one torpedo. The Yamato takes on about 3000 tons of water, the North Carolina 1000 tons. JUst from this it would seem the torpedo protection on the North Carolina is better. But it is merely one torpedo. Depending upon where the hit was, the damage can by highly variable, as could the amount of flooding. As the Yamato and her sister the Musahi took 12-20 torpedoes prior to sinking (notice I did not say "in order to sink them") in addition to a lot of bomb damage it is hard to fault the overall effects of these vessels torpedo protection systems. I think part of the issue stems from the Yamato's lower belt extending deeper than on most battleships. I might add though that the Iowa and South Dakota classes had a deeper belt as well, and the rigidity of a deeper belt is often thought to be a negative factor on the Yamato class for torpedo protection. It is thought that a less rigid armor scheme protects better against the concussive force of a torpedo hit. So why is the Yamato class maligned for it's extension of it's lower belt, while the other american BB's are not? My guess is that with enough torpedo hits, you would see some breakdown caused by problems with the lower armor belt of the America Battleships. As we have on record only a single torpedo hit on an american battleship, we can never see this theory tested.

But the real point is we cannot look at the effects of one torpedo striking each vessel and determine the effectiveness of the torpedo defense systems. For if we extrapolate the amount of water taken in vs. ship displacement of these two vessels, one could argue that it would take 20-33 torpedoes to sink the North Carolina, and I do not feel that is at all accurate.

The Prince of Wales could possible been sunk by the first torpedo that hit her. If this would have indeed happened, should we surmise that this class of battleship could be sunk by one torpedo? Or should we assume there was a lucky hit?

I'd think the KG5 class was not the best protected vs. torpedoes, not because of the hit sustained but largely because the narrowness of the voids, 13 feet vs 17.5' for the American classes, or 23.5' for the Yamato or Vittorio Veneto.
